Erateek.
Home
Brand Identity
Logos, Complete Identity
Web Development
E-commerce, Corporate Sites
Digital Marketing
SEO, Campaign Management
Graphic Design
Social Media, Print
Content Creation
Copywriting, Motion Graphics
Mobile Apps
iOS, Android, Native
BlogAboutContact
Arabic✨Get a QuoteContact
Menu
HomeBlogAboutContactGet a Quote✨

Services

Brand Identity
Logos, Complete Identity
Web Development
E-commerce, Corporate Sites
Digital Marketing
SEO, Campaign Management
Graphic Design
Social Media, Print
Content Creation
Copywriting, Motion Graphics
Mobile Apps
iOS, Android, Native
Back to Blog
TechnologyErateekMobile App DevelopmentFlutterReact Native

Mobile App Development Showdown: Flutter vs React Native

Suhaib Gamal - Erateek Team
Suhaib Gamal - Erateek TeamEditorial Team
May 11, 2026
5 min read
New
Mobile App Development Showdown: Flutter vs React Native

Introduction

The world of mobile app development has witnessed a significant surge in recent years, with businesses and individuals alike seeking to create engaging, user-friendly, and feature-rich applications. Two popular frameworks that have gained widespread attention are Flutter and React Native. Both frameworks allow developers to build cross-platform apps, but they differ in their approach, architecture, and use cases. In this article, we will delve into the details of Flutter and React Native, exploring their strengths, weaknesses, and industry trends, as well as why Erateek is the ideal choice for your mobile app development needs.

Deep Dive into Flutter

Flutter is an open-source mobile app development framework created by Google. It allows developers to build natively compiled applications for mobile, web, and desktop from a single codebase. Flutter uses the Dart programming language, which is easy to learn and provides a rich set of libraries and tools. One of the key benefits of Flutter is its fast development cycle, which enables developers to see the changes they make to the codebase in real-time. Additionally, Flutter provides a rich set of pre-built widgets, making it easy to create custom user interfaces. Flutter is also known for its excellent performance, with apps built using the framework providing a seamless and responsive user experience.

Deep Dive into React Native

React Native is an open-source framework developed by Facebook. It allows developers to build cross-platform apps using JavaScript and React. React Native uses a bridge to communicate between the JavaScript code and the native platform, enabling developers to access native APIs and components. One of the key benefits of React Native is its large community of developers, which provides a wealth of resources, libraries, and tools. React Native also provides a fast development cycle, with features like hot reloading and live reloading. However, React Native can be more challenging to learn, especially for developers without prior experience with JavaScript or React.

Technical Details

When it comes to technical details, both Flutter and React Native have their strengths and weaknesses. Flutter uses a custom rendering engine, Skia, which provides excellent performance and graphics capabilities. React Native, on the other hand, uses the native platform's rendering engine, which can result in varying performance across different platforms. In terms of architecture, Flutter uses a widget-based approach, whereas React Native uses a component-based approach. Both frameworks provide a range of tools and libraries, including support for popular packages like Firebase and GraphQL. However, Flutter's use of Dart can be a barrier for some developers, while React Native's use of JavaScript can make it easier to integrate with existing web applications.

Industry Trends

The mobile app development industry is constantly evolving, with new trends and technologies emerging every year. One of the key trends is the increasing demand for cross-platform apps, which can run on multiple platforms with minimal modifications. Both Flutter and React Native are well-positioned to meet this demand, with their ability to build apps for multiple platforms from a single codebase. Another trend is the growing importance of user experience, with users expecting apps to be fast, responsive, and visually appealing. Flutter's excellent performance and rich set of pre-built widgets make it an attractive choice for building apps with a high-quality user experience. Additionally, the use of artificial intelligence and machine learning is becoming increasingly popular, with both frameworks providing support for these technologies.

Why Erateek

At Erateek, we have extensive experience in mobile app development, with a team of expert developers who are proficient in both Flutter and React Native. We understand the importance of choosing the right framework for your project, and we can help you make an informed decision based on your specific needs and requirements. Our team is dedicated to delivering high-quality apps that meet the latest industry trends and standards, with a focus on providing an excellent user experience. Whether you're looking to build a cross-platform app, a native app, or a hybrid app, we have the expertise and resources to help you achieve your goals. With Erateek, you can be confident that your mobile app development project is in good hands, and that we will work closely with you to ensure that your app meets your expectations and exceeds your users' expectations.

Conclusion

In conclusion, both Flutter and React Native are powerful frameworks for mobile app development, with their own strengths and weaknesses. The choice between the two ultimately depends on your specific needs and requirements, as well as your team's expertise and experience. At Erateek, we are committed to helping you make the right choice for your project, and to delivering high-quality apps that meet the latest industry trends and standards. With our expertise in Flutter and React Native, as well as our commitment to providing an excellent user experience, we are the ideal partner for your mobile app development needs. Contact us today to learn more about how we can help you achieve your mobile app development goals.

Inspired by this article?

Share these insights with your network and start a discussion.

Contact Us

Recommended for you

Articles you might find interesting

View all articles
The Explosion of Social Commerce & Shoppable Video
General1/1/1970

The Explosion of Social Commerce & Shoppable Video

Social media is no longer just for engagement. Learn how shoppable video and in-app checkouts are turning platforms like TikTok and Instagram into major storefronts.

Read more
Privacy-First Marketing: Winning in a Cookie-Less World
General1/1/1970

Privacy-First Marketing: Winning in a Cookie-Less World

With third-party cookies gone, first-party data is gold. Discover strategies to build trust and collect meaningful customer data in 2025.

Read more
AI Agents: The New 'Chief Simplifier' in Marketing
General1/1/1970

AI Agents: The New 'Chief Simplifier' in Marketing

Forget simple chatbots. In 2025, autonomous AI agents are taking over complex workflows, data analysis, and hyper-personalized customer interactions.

Read more
Contact
Erateek.

Let's create something extraordinary together.

Start Project

Company

  • About Us
  • Services
  • Blog
  • Contact

Services

  • Web Development
  • Brand Identity
  • Digital Marketing
  • Content Creation

Quick Links

  • Privacy Policy
  • Terms & Conditions
  • FAQ

© 2026 Erateek Agency. All rights reserved.